Human Geography I: One Earth - Many Worlds (University of Zurich)

Abstract
Imparting of research questions and basic principles in Human Geography
Objective
You will be able to present basic theoretical principles, facts and concepts on the following topics of human geography and apply them to simple examples: - Society and space: basic perspectives of human geography, spatial concepts, forms of society, globalization. - State in globalization: sovereignty, borders, nation, identity. - Economy in the global age: commodity chains, labor relations and business strategies. - Cities in the context of global transformations: Global urbanization processes, urban spatial developments, urban living conditions. You know the basics of scientific work in human geography and can apply them in a small project.
